LeviLamina
Loading...
Searching...
No Matches
Editor::Services::EditorPersistenceServiceProvider Member List

This is the complete list of members for Editor::Services::EditorPersistenceServiceProvider, including all inherited members.

createGroup(::std::string const &namespacedName, ::Editor::Services::PersistenceScope scope, ::std::optional< int > version, ::std::optional<::Editor::Services::PersistenceGroupType > groupType)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
deleteGroup(::std::string const &namespacedName, ::Editor::Services::PersistenceScope scope, ::std::optional< int > version)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
deleteGroup(::StackRefResult<::Editor::Services::PersistenceGroup > const group)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
fetchGroups(::std::optional<::std::string > groupNamespace, ::std::optional<::std::string > namespacedName, ::std::optional<::Editor::Services::PersistenceScope > scope, ::std::optional< int > version)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
getGroup(::std::string const &namespacedName, ::Editor::Services::PersistenceScope scope, ::std::optional< int > version)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
getOrCreateGroup(::std::string const &namespacedName, ::Editor::Services::PersistenceScope scope, ::std::optional< int > version, ::std::optional<::Editor::Services::PersistenceGroupType > groupType)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
requestGroup(::std::string const &namespacedName, ::Editor::Services::PersistenceScope scope, ::std::optional< int > version, ::std::function< void(::Scripting::Result_deprecated<::StackRefResult<::Editor::Services::PersistenceGroup > >)> callback)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
syncAndSaveGroup(::StackRefResult<::Editor::Services::PersistenceGroup > group)=0 (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Providerpure virtual
~EditorPersistenceServiceProvider()=default (defined in Editor::Services::EditorPersistenceServiceProvider)Editor::Services::EditorPersistenceServiceProvidervirtual